On behalf of the Human Interactivity and Language Lab, University of Warsaw and IEEE Robotics and Automation Society we have the pleasure to invite you to
4th Summer School on Human-Robot Interaction
September 18-23, 2023, Chęciny, Poland
Application deadline: 5th May, 2023
We welcome PhD students, MA students and young researchers with backgrounds in robotics and/or language and communication, seeking to deepen their knowledge and hands-on experience in social human-robot interaction.

We invite you to 5 days of intense learning: Keynote lectures in the morning, followed by hands-on workshops, discussion panels and social activities in the evenings. The School aims at reframing some of the key questions in HRI, which are pertinent both to social and to general robotics. The Summer School is organized under the auspices of two IEEE RAS Technical Committees (Cognitive Robotics TC and Human-Robot Interaction TC) and is co-financed by the European Union’s Horizon 2020 TRAINCREASE project (No 952324), EU H2020 PERSEO (No 955778), and IEEE RAS Summer Schools programme.
